少儿编程主要是做什么工作
-
少儿编程主要是帮助儿童学习编程的一项教育活动。通过少儿编程,孩子们可以学习到计算机科学的基本概念和原理,并且通过编程语言进行实践操作。具体来说,少儿编程主要包括以下几方面的工作:
1.引导孩子学习基础知识:少儿编程始于基础,教孩子了解计算机、编程语言、数据结构等基础知识。通过学习,孩子可以了解计算机的工作原理,掌握基本的编程思维方式和理念。
2.培养逻辑思维能力:编程过程需要进行逻辑思维,培养孩子的逻辑思维能力是少儿编程的重要内容。通过编程,孩子可以学习到问题分析、数据处理、算法设计等方面的逻辑思维方法。
3.培养创新能力:编程不仅仅是按照既定的规则进行操作,还需要在解决问题的过程中发挥创新能力。少儿编程通过学习和实践,培养孩子的创造力和创新思维,激发孩子的创造潜能。
4.培养团队合作能力:编程过程中,往往需要多人合作完成一个项目。通过团队合作,孩子可以学习到沟通、合作、协作等能力,培养他们的团队合作精神。
5.培养问题解决能力:编程过程中,常常会遇到各种问题和挑战。通过解决编程问题,孩子可以培养解决问题的能力,并且在解决问题中提升自己的思考能力和创造力。
总的来说,少儿编程的主要工作就是通过教育和培训,帮助孩子学习编程知识和技能,培养他们的逻辑思维、创造力、团队合作和问题解决能力,为他们未来的学习和职业发展打下坚实的基础。
1年前 -
少儿编程主要是为了教育和培养孩子们的计算思维和创造力。以下是少儿编程的主要工作:
-
教授编程基础知识:少儿编程课程通常会教授一些基础的计算机科学知识,如算法、数据结构、逻辑思维等。学生会学习编程语言的基本语法和编写简单的代码,如Python、Scratch等。
-
培养解决问题的能力:通过编程实践,学生可以学会如何分析和解决问题。他们需要思考如何将一个大问题分解成更小的子问题,并设计解决方案。这个过程培养了学生的逻辑思维和系统思考能力。
-
激发创造力和创新意识:编程可以帮助孩子们发展自己的创造力和想象力。他们可以设计自己的游戏、动画和应用程序,从而在编程的过程中实现自己的想法。这种创造性的实践可以激发孩子们的创新意识和创造力。
-
培养团队合作和沟通能力:在少儿编程的学习中,学生通常会参与到项目中,与其他学生一起合作完成一个编程任务。这样可以培养学生的团队合作和沟通能力,他们需要学会与其他人有效地合作和交流,共同解决问题。
-
培养未来就业技能:计算机科学和编程是未来就业市场上的热门领域。通过学习少儿编程,孩子们可以获得在科技行业中需要的技能,为将来的就业做好准备。他们可以学会软件开发、网页设计、机器人技术等技能,为未来的职业发展打下基础。
1年前 -
-
少儿编程主要是教授儿童学习计算机编程的基础知识和技能,帮助他们了解和理解计算机科学的基本概念和原理,以及培养他们的逻辑思维、创造力、解决问题的能力。少儿编程的工作可以包括以下几个方面:
-
设计编程课程:少儿编程教师需要根据儿童的年龄和学习能力,设计相应的编程课程。不同阶段的课程内容需要根据孩子的认知水平和兴趣爱好来确定,从简单的迷宫游戏到复杂的算法设计,让孩子逐步掌握编程的基本概念和技能。
-
教授编程知识:教师需要通过课堂教学、示范和练习等方式,向学生介绍计算机编程的基本知识,如变量、条件语句、循环等。教师需要通过生动有趣的教学方法,使学生容易理解和吸收课程内容。
-
引导编程实践:除了教授编程知识,少儿编程还注重培养学生的实践能力。教师需要组织学生参与编程实践活动,例如编写简单的程序、制作游戏等。通过实际操作,学生可以理解和掌握编程的应用技巧和解决问题的方法。
-
培养创造力和解决问题的能力:少儿编程教师不仅需要教授编程技术,还需要培养学生的创造力和解决问题的能力。教师可以通过提供挑战性的编程任务,引导学生思考和创新。同时,教师还需要指导学生如何分析问题、找到解决问题的方法和步骤。
-
跟踪学生学习进展:教师需要定期跟踪学生的学习进展,评估他们对编程知识的掌握程度,并及时给予反馈和指导。对于有问题或进步较慢的学生,教师还可以提供个性化的辅导和帮助,帮助他们克服困难,提高学习效果。
总而言之,少儿编程教师的主要工作是设计教学课程、教授编程知识、引导编程实践、培养创造力和解决问题的能力,并跟踪学生学习进展,帮助他们全面发展。这些工作可以通过采用创新的教学方法和教育资源来实现,使儿童在愉快的学习氛围中获得编程知识和技能。
1年前 -